I see three options:
1. Lap the scope rings. This might not can be done depending on your scope rings. If you have what I think you have, you'll have to go to #2.
2. Change scope rings. Admittedly a lot of respected shooters here like the one piece scope/scope base. I'm not a fan of them. I tried them once, and it didn't match up well w/ the turrets on my scope, preventing me from moving th scope in the rings frontward or backward. For a number of years, only I've used a one piece Weaver slot base w/ Burris Weaver type Signature Z-rings (the ones w/ the plastic inserts). Since I've been using these rings, I no longer lap the scope rings. On my XP 100 handguns chambered in <30 caliber, I use 2 rings (even in the 284 Win); if chambered in 30 caliber or higher, I use 3 rings. Which brings me to option #3.
3. Add a third ring.
